I was there about 2 weeks ago. I found it to be a nice property. I was only able to get to the CL one evening, but they had "real food" (meatballs with brown gravy and pasta), plus the usual veggies, cheese, and a pretty good fresh salsa and guacamole. But the best part is that the CL is open 24 hours a day during the week...great for late night sodas! And speaking of which, they had Dr. Pepper and Diet Dr. Pepper in addition to the usual Pepsi product assortment. If you like coffee, they had several varieties available, plus flavored syrups. Overall I highly recommend the property, including the lounge.

sanFF Sep 13, 2010 11:32 am

Just got back
 
CL was great but closed friday noon until sunday afternoon.
Got upgraded to CL (As a silver) but had to beg plead. Check in staff is
better equipped to run a morgue but Vanesa was a charm when checking out.
Great breakfast and supper. Wine a rip at $11.00 a gllass (meridan)
Do not expect a balcony. It is actually a ledge. We moved to a poatio room in the courtyard and loved it. Would go back if on points or weekend as it clears out and has a great $99 rate. This is def a bus hotel.:p
